Dealerships charge more

You're not the only person who has lost their Ford car key. There are 15 million Ford vehicles on the road. However, there's a thing you need to know before visiting a dealership for a replacement key: dealerships will charge you more for this service. First of all the car's key is programmed by the dealer using a specific machine, and the majority of dealerships don't have the capability to program keys. Additionally, dealers may charge more for after-hours assistance that can increase the cost by 25 to 50 percent.

A locksmith can provide an exact copy of your car key for between $150 and $250 If you're unable to find it at a dealer. You'll be required to provide the car's VIN to get a duplicate of the key. The difficulty of making the key will affect the cost.
